About FloDynamix™ 

FloDynamix had its beginning in early 2007 with the aim of providing solutions that substantially reduce unplanned leaks and spillage due to component failures. Fugitive emissions from control valves as well as secondary Mechanical Seal failures in pumps contribute to loss of productivity and endangers health & safety of employees and surrounding community.  With environmental concerns at heart, FloDynamix strives in providing the most technologically sound products that keep cost of ownership at minimum while protecting people and assets. In 2008 FloDynamix and Nugeneration Technologies joined forces to better serve the market.  While trained as Engineers & Scientists, FloDynamix founders have over 50 years of combined industry experience in Oil and Gas, Chemical Processing & Electronics industries.  NuGenTec adds to it's core competancy by joining forces with FloDynamix LLC. Latest FloDynamix News 

September 2009: FloDynamix Announces U.S. Made Gumlast™ L8010 Successfully Benchmarked Against Kalrez® 6375
Nugeneration Technologies (NuGenTec) announced (September 08, 2009) that it's Gumlast™ L8010 has been successfully benchmarked against Kalrez® 6375 at Chevron Richmond refinery. Gumlast™ L8010 is 100% pure FFKM and is manufactured in the U.S.A. 


APRIL 2009:
FloDynamix LLC of Rohnert Park, CA has introduced Gumlast® L7509 perfluoroelastomer for contamination sensitive Semicon processes.  Gumlast L7509 is crystal clear, un-filled perfluoro with extremely low out-gassing properties–first of its kind.  It is ideal for ALD (Atomic Layer Deposition) and MOCVD (Metal Organic Chemical Vapour Deposition) processes where moisture out-gassing from sealing components interferes with film stochiometry and uniformity.  Gumlast L7509 is manufactured in The United States in a cleanroom environment.  In addition, Gumlast L7509 exhibits very low sticking properties which has been a key drawback of many translucent perfluoros in the market.  For further information, please contact Fred Pourmirzaie at fpour@flodynamix.com

EU court rejects appeal on price-fixing fines
BRUSSELS (Feb. 3, 2012)—The European Union General Court has rejected appeals by DuPont Co., Dow Chemical Co., and Denki Kagaku Kogyo K.K. against fines imposed by the EU for their participation in a cartel to fix prices of polychloroprene rubber.
